We are seeking an experienced and compassionate Registered Nurse (RN) Labor & Delivery to join a high-performing maternal care team. The ideal candidate will have recent Labor & Delivery experience and demonstrate strong clinical judgment excellent patient communication and the ability to thrive in a fast-paced environment while delivering exceptional care to mothers and newborns.
Responsibilities
Provide comprehensive nursing care to laboring delivering and postpartum patients in accordance with established standards of practice
Assess monitor and document maternal and fetal status throughout labor and delivery
Administer medications treatments and interventions as ordered
Assist physicians and interdisciplinary teams during labor delivery and emergency situations
Monitor fetal heart tracings and identify changes requiring intervention
Educate patients and families regarding labor progression delivery expectations recovery and newborn care
Support patient safety initiatives and maintain accurate medical documentation
Collaborate with obstetricians anesthesiology neonatal teams and support staff to coordinate patient care
Respond effectively to obstetric emergencies while maintaining a calm and patient-centered approach
Qualifications
Active Pennsylvania Registered Nurse (RN) License required
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N) required
Minimum 2 years of recent Labor & Delivery RN experience required
Current American Heart Association (AHA) Basic Life Support (BLS) certification required
Current American Heart Association (AHA) Advanced Cardiovascular Life Support (ACLS) certification required
Strong assessment communication and critical thinking skills
